Built by Women DC / BxW DC is a crowd-sourced competition organized by the Beverly Willis Architecture Foundation (BWAF) to recognize and support the diverse women working in design and construction in and around Washington D.C. BWAF works to change the culture of the built environment professions through “documenting women’s work,” “educating the public,” and “transforming the industry.”

This year the organization recognized 110 buildings, structures, and other built environments, either contemporary or historic, designed or constructed by women in the Washington, D.C. region. The winning sites included projects from Civic, Commercial, Cultural, Institutional, Landscape, Mixed-Use, Residential, Transportation, and Urban Design categories.
